What is 126 How to keep readers hooked with Christian White, author of The Long Night about?
In episode 126, internationally bestselling author Christian White describes, in graphic detail, how he thinks of his readers as lobsters. He also shares how his grandmother convinced him to fear trees (but only at night) and why he finds comfort in horror stories, like his latest novel, The Long Night. Plus, he shares his one key takeaway – and it's not what you'd expect. Christian White is an Australian author and screenwriter whose credits include feature film Relic and Netflix series Clickbait. His debut novel The Nowhere Child was one of Australia's bestselling debut novels ever, with rights sold in 17 international territories and a major screen deal. The Wife and the Widow, Wild Place and The Ledge were all instant bestsellers. The Long Night is his fifth novel.
